摘要

肿瘤免疫治疗已经彻底改变了各种恶性肿瘤的治疗前景。免疫检查点抑制剂(Immune checkpoint inhibitors, ICIs)和嵌合抗原受体t细胞疗法(chimeric antigen receptor T-cell therapy, CAR-T)作为肿瘤免疫治疗的代表,在临床实践中取得了巨大的成功,已成为某些肿瘤的一线临床治疗选择。本文综述了免疫检查点抑制剂和CAR-T疗法在肿瘤治疗中的进展和面临的挑战,并讨论了肿瘤治疗性疫苗的未来发展方向。在肿瘤免疫学领域确定新的治疗靶点,设计创新的药物输送系统,并采用组合治疗策略,可以提高肿瘤的治疗效果和患者预后,从而使更广泛的患者群体受益。

[Research progress of ICI and CAR-T in tumor immunotherapy].

Tumor immunotherapy has revolutionized the treatment prospects for various malignant tumors. Immune checkpoint inhibitors (ICIs) and chimeric antigen receptor T-cell therapy (CAR-T) , as representative of tumor immunotherapy, have achieved tremendous success in clinical practice and have become the first-line clinical treatment options for certain tumors. This article summarizes the progress and challenges of immune checkpoint inhibitors and CAR-T therapy in tumor treatment, and discusses the future direction of tumor therapeutic vaccines development. Identifying novel therapeutic targets within the realm of tumor immunology, engineering innovative drug delivery systems, and employing combinatorial therapeutic strategies are poised to enhance therapeutic efficacy and patient outcomes in oncology, thereby extending benefits to a broader patient population.
